uShaka celebrates Women’s Month

Women are treated with specials and fun entertainment this month at uShaka Marine World.

FROM unlimited fun to specials, with uShaka there is more in the month of August.

All women pay a children’s price of R147 to enter Sea World during this month, and there will be numerous massage therapists from Mangwanani and Patdee Spa offering reduced priced pampering within the food court area.

There will also be live entertainment throughout the park for all to enjoy on Friday, 9 August, Women’s day, featuring talented singer, Egal, who will be getting all the women into the spirit of celebration, while the Zulu dancers and the gogos will be performing throughout uShaka Marine World.

On Saturday, 10 August the Mr and Miss uShaka Marine World Regional competition will be held in the Village Walk Food Court from 11am until 4pm, and on Sunday, 11 August, the Zulu dancers and the marimba band will be performing in the Village Walk.
